Global Distribution Systems (GDS) play a crucial role in the travel industry, revolutionizing the way travel agencies and companies connect with travelers and facilitate bookings. One key reason why GDS is vital to the travel industry is its ability to provide a centralized platform for accessing and booking travel-related services. Through GDS platforms, travel agents can access real-time information on flights, accommodations, car rentals, and more, allowing them to provide comprehensive and up-to-date travel options to their customers. This seamless connection between travel providers and agents streamlines the booking process and enhances the overall booking experience for travelers.

The importance of GDS extends to B2C booking systems as it allows travel agencies to enhance their online presence and cater to a wider audience of tech-savvy travelers. By integrating GDS into their B2C booking systems, travel companies can offer customers a user-friendly interface to search, compare, and book travel services directly. This level of automation not only saves time but also ensures accuracy in bookings, reducing the risk of errors or miscommunication. As a result, travelers benefit from a convenient way to plan and book their trips, while travel companies improve their operational efficiency and customer service delivery through these integrated solutions.

Furthermore, the development of flight booking engines is another area where the significance of GDS in the travel industry is evident. flight booking engine development relies heavily on GDS to access airline inventories, flight schedules, and pricing information in real-time. By leveraging GDS data and functionalities, developers can create robust flight booking engines that offer travelers a comprehensive selection of flights, prices, and options to choose from. This not only empowers travelers to make informed decisions but also enables travel companies to maximize their reach and revenue by tapping into a vast network of available flights and fares from various airlines.
